The ABCs of CT Landlord/Tenant Mobile Manufactured Home Communities

At their most basic level, leases are contracts between landlords and tenants that set forth the legal rights and obligations of the parties. Leases offer guidelines and parameters governing the parties’ conduct concerning the use and occupancy of real property. Leases are important in any landlord-tenant relationship, but they take on extra significance for mobile home park owners and residents.

Mobile Home Evictions in CT: A Basic Overview for Landlords

In Connecticut, eviction cases are referred to as summary process actions, and they are generally governed by the Connecticut Landlord Tenant Act. Special rules apply to evictions for tenants (or residents) living in mobile home parks, depending on whether the resident owns their mobile home. These rules are found in the Mobile Manufactured Home Act, or Chapter 412 of the General Statutes. This article offers a basic overview of mobile home evictions and what park owners can expect when a case goes to court, focusing on situations where the resident rents the land but owns their home.
